FLCompanion does account for larger than 1 unit size. You need to adjust your settings to show the cargo maximum of the ship you're flying, instead of a 1-unit setting. 1-unit setting shows no difference based on cargo size requirement. But if, say, you changed it to a 5,000 cargo setting, than it will account for the cargo need differences, and will accurately show you the routes.


EDIT: FLCompanion should be used for all route calculations, not FLStat. Use FLStat to find sale locations of an item, yes. Then go to that station in FLCompanion and find the routes leaving it (also works for places to sell a certain commodity).


FLstat and bastille - Mere_Mortal - 01-06-2012

There is that option, but it still doesn't care about volume. For example, if you take Aomori Station you will see VIPs atop at 1140 profit per second, per unit. The reality is that it's only a fifth of that because of the volume, so in actual fact H-Fuel is technically the most profitable route from that station.
